Mengenal Langkah Penting Dalam Mengembangkan Mobile Apps Untuk Bisnis Anda

 


Memahami langkah-langkah penting dalam proses pengembangan mobile apps mungkin terlihat  seperti tugas yang menantang. Ada beberapa hal yang dapat menghambat keberhasilan dari perilisan mobile apps. Misalnya seperti vendor developer yang tidak cocok untuk proyek Anda dari sudut pandang teknis dan budaya.
 
Mengembangkan mobile apps, website atau software khusus  apa pun tidak hanya berbicara tentang ide atau pengetahuan teknis pengembangan developer backend dan proses desain dari mobile apps.
 
Elemen lain seperti budaya yang tepat, menentukan model bisnis, mengetahui cara mengatur peluncuran mobile apps, merancang desain UI / UX, dan memilih media sosial dan strategi pemasaran yang tepat juga mempengaruhi kinerja dari mobile apps untuk bisnis Anda.
 
Mitra vendor developer dari mobile apps yang ideal akan melihat bisnis mitranya secara holistik sebelum mengembangkan mobile apps yang mendefinisikan pengalaman pengguna yang berkualitas untuk pelanggannya. Tim dan vendor developer yang berkualitas harus melakukan analisis bisnis mendalam sebelum proses pengembangan mobile apps dilaksanakan.
 
Analisis bisnis ini sangat penting untuk menghasilkan ide, pengembangan konsep produk, pengujian konsep, dan pengujian pemasaran. Tanpa masukan awal dari ide produk dan sudut pandang kelayakan teknis, akan sulit mengembangkan mobile apps yang memenuhi kebutuhan pelanggan dan tujuan bisnis.
 
Ada berbagai cara untuk mendekati berbagai tahapan proses pengembangan mobile apps. Terkadang penting bagi Anda untuk untuk menggunakan pendekatan pengembangan mobile apps yang umum dan konseptual.
 
Di sisi lain, fokus operasional adalah pendekatan yang lebih nyaman dalam proses pengembangan dari mobile apps. Saat memulai proses pengembangan amobile apps, Anda perlu memilih pendekatan terbaik untuk bisnis Anda.
 
Apapun jalur pengembangan mobile apps yang Anda pilih pasti akan menjadi proses pengembangan mobile apps yang sangat bermanfaat jika dilakukan dengan benar. Yang terpenting, hal ini pasti akan mengarahkan Anda untuk membangun mobile apps yang sukses jika Anda mempertimbangkan detail kecilnya.
 
Dalam artikel ini, kami mencoba membantu bisnis Anda dalam fase pengembangan mobile apps dalam siklus hidup produknya. Jika developer dari mobile apps Anda memiliki pengalaman yang tepat, berikut beberapa tahap penting yang perlu mereka pahami.
 
 
 
 
Langkah Penting Dalam Pengembangan Mobile Apps Untuk Bisnis Anda
 
Menyusun langkah-langkah proses pengembangan mobile apps dapat terasa sulit karena sering kali tidak mengikuti jalur linier. Sebaliknya, hal ini adalah proses berkelanjutan di mana developer terus-menerus berpartisipasi dalam proses peninjauan yang ketat sebelum perilisan produk digital hingga akhir.
 
Untuk mobile apps, terkadang perlu bolak-balik beberapa kali antar tahap pengembangan produk hingga Anda mendapatkan strategi pengembangan mobile apps yang tepat. Tujuan akhirnya adalah untuk menyenangkan target pasar dari bisnis Anda.
 
Pengguna mobile apps modern memiliki ekspektasi yang tinggi, dan penting untuk mencoba memenuhi atau melampaui ekspektasi tersebut dengan pengalaman pengguna yang berkualitas. Bahkan mungkin saja proses pengembangan mobile apps mengharuskan tim Anda untuk mengkaji lebih jauh dan menganalisis strategi pasar serta mengubah ide yang mendasarinya. 
 
Tidak mengherankan jika semua mobile apps, termasuk mobile apps dengan sistem iOS dan Android, menuntut produk digital yang melalui banyak tahap pengembangan secara  berulang sebelum produk akhir dapat dirilis.
 
Saat mengembangkan mobile apps, Anda harus mempertimbangkan dua pilar besar dalam menciptakan produk digital terkait yaitu : 
 
 
Design Thinking -  Proses pembuatan ide dan pengujian di mana tim mengetahui bahwa mereka tidak memiliki semua jawaban. Hal ini memerlukan beberapa iterasi pengembangan konsep dan pengujian melalui langkah-langkah pengembangan yang berbeda hingga Anda memiliki sesuatu yang berhasil. Hal terakhir ini dikenal sebagai Minimum Viable Product (MVP).
 
Agile Development -  Merupakan metodologi manajemen proyek berulang yang memungkinkan tim mobile apps bekerja lebih cepat dan efisien, serta mengoptimalkan sumber daya seiring berjalannya waktu. Melaluinya, proses pengembangan produk menjadi bagian penting untuk menjamin kesuksesan jangka panjang dari mobile apps Anda.
 
Keseluruhan proses pembuatan mobile apps mencakup lebih dari sekadar tahap pengembangan. Siklus hidup produk yang lengkap berisi langkah-langkah berikut: menemukan, merancang, mengembangkan, dan merilis.
 
Namun, sebagian besar profesional manajemen proyek pengembangan mobile apps setuju bahwa dukungan dan pemeliharaan juga harus dimasukkan dalam siklus hidup produk digital.
 
Anda perlu memahami bahwa Anda tidak dapat memiliki produk yang sukses tanpa dukungan dan pemeliharaan berkelanjutan. Oleh karena itu, pastikan Anda memperhitungkan pemeliharaan dan dukungan dalam peta jalan produk Anda jika Anda ingin membuat produk akhir yang akan bertahan dalam ujian waktu.
 
Sebenarnya, proses pengembangan produk digital seperti mobile apps sebenarnya mengacu pada langkah-langkah siklus hidup seperti berikut : 
 
  • Pahami persyaratannya
  • Merancang solusi sejak awal
  • Menerapkan dan menguji solusinya
  • Refaktorisasi untuk mengoptimalkan
  • Memberikan solusi.

 
 
Memahami Persyaratannya & Ketentuan Yang Dibutuhkan
 
Apa rencana dan tujuan dari pengembangan mobile apps untuk bisnis Anda? Bagaimana cara mengembangkannya? Siapa saja target pengguna yang akan menggunakannya? Sistem operasi apa yang akan digunakan? Berapa anggaran pengembangan mobile apps Anda? Hal ini adalah beberapa pertanyaan yang mungkin ingin Anda tanyakan pada diri Anda dan tim developer selama fase awal pengembangan mobile apps.
 
Hal ini mungkin tampak seperti masalah mendasar, tetapi Anda perlu menghindari pengerjaan ulang yang mahal di masa depan jika Anda dapat menyelesaikannya dengan benar dan menentukan fungsionalitas inti sebelum pengembangan berjalan. Misalnya, pengembangan aplikasi hybrid berbeda dengan pengembangan aplikasi Native dalam hal biaya, pendekatan, dan hasil.
 
Selain itu, menjawab pertanyaan-pertanyaan ini juga dapat membantu Anda melihat gambaran besar tentang kesesuaian mobile apps dengan model dan strategi bisnis Anda. Harapan Anda sering kali menemui hambatan ketika proses pengembangan mobile apps dimulai, jadi hal terpenting adalah bersikap realistis mengenai cakupannya.
Anda tidak memerlukan konsep produk yang dikembangkan sepenuhnya sebelum pengembangan dimulai. Namun, sejumlah definisi produk membantu pengembangan berulang dan memberi manajer produk dan tim pengembangan Anda tempat untuk memulai. Saat mengembangkan mobile apps, hal ini harus dijelaskan kepada developer dari produk Anda untuk tujuan komunikasi. 
 
Pastikan semua orang memahami dasar-dasar konsep dari mobile apps Anda, dan Anda akan berada di jalur yang benar. Gagal melakukannya, kemungkinan besar pengembangan mobile app Anda pada akhirnya akan gagal.
 
Persyaratan pengembangan mobile apps yang jelas dan ringkas dapat membantu merevisi asumsi harga dan budget Anda. Namun, mengembangkan ide yang benar-benar baru seringkali bukanlah layanan yang murah. 
 
Semakin banyak pekerjaan yang perlu Anda lakukan untuk mempersempit konsep produk dan memperbaiki kesalahan dalam pengembangan, semakin lama waktu yang dibutuhkan tim developer untuk menghasilkan software yang mudah digunakan, dan semakin mahal biayanya.
 
 
 
 
Merancang Desain Solusi Awal Yang Diperlukan / Hipotesis
 
Cara terbaik untuk menyempurnakan pengembangan mobile apps dari bisnis Anda adalah dengan melanjutkan dan mulai membuatnya. Hanya dengan melakukan hal ini produk Anda akan dapat berkembang menjadi apa yang Anda inginkan. Jika tidak, Anda hanya akan berputar-putar di sekitar ide, yang tidak akan membawa hasil apa pun dalam hal eksekusi.
 
Prototipe didasarkan pada hipotesis awal Anda. Hal ini dapat merangkum asumsi dan memungkinkan Anda untuk mengujinya. Selain itu, hal ini membantu Anda menyempurnakan produk saat Anda beralih dari apa yang tidak berhasil ke apa yang berhasil. Untuk ini, proses desain aplikasi memainkan peran penting. Idealnya, desain aplikasi harus dimulai dengan wireframe dasar dan berkembang dari sana.
 
 
Menerapkan & Menguji Solusi Yang Diinginkan 
 
Setelah Anda mendapatkan hal yang perlu dapat Anda uji, sekarang saatnya untuk melanjutkan ke langkah berikutnya untuk memastikannya mudah digunakan. Pengujian beta tidak mengharuskan Anda memiliki versi apps  yang lengkap; Anda dapat memulai pengujian dengan Produk Minimum yang Layak (minimum viable product).
 
Dengan kata lain, semua fitur dari mobile apps bisnis Anda tidak perlu disiapkan sebelum memulai pengujian penerimaan pengguna. Setelah fungsi inti produk Anda berfungsi, mulailah mengujinya dengan pengguna dunia nyata. Hal yang baik tentang Agile Development adalah memungkinkan Anda menguji fitur aplikasi seluler secara terpisah.
 
Pengujian aplikasi dapat menghemat banyak pengerjaan ulang, karena dapat membantu Anda melihat tampilan aplikasi pada berbagai perangkat dan platform seluler. Selain itu, hal ini dapat membantu Anda menerapkan produk Anda di app store dengan lebih cepat, baik untuk Google Play Store, Apple App Store, atau keduanya.
 
 
Merilis Solusi Mobile Apps Untuk Pengguna
 
Perilisan mobile apps mungkin menjadi langkah terakhir, tetapi hal ini adalah akhir dari banyak iterasi pertama dalam siklus hidup pengembangan sebuah mobile apps. 
 
Terkadang solusinya memerlukan beberapa penyesuaian sebelum diterapkan. Bahkan setelah sampai di pasar, mungkin masih ada hal yang perlu Anda dilakukan. Hal ini tidak menjadi masalah jika Anda telah mengembangkan kelayakan produk secara minimal (MVP) yang kuat. Hal yang terpenting adalah tim developer Anda senantiasa memastikan untuk melakukan perbaikan dan pembaruan aplikasi secara berkelanjutan.
 
Solusi tidak sama dengan produk jadi. Pada langkah sini, siklus pengembangan dimulai lagi. Lagi pula, selalu ada beberapa layanan keamanan, pemeliharaan, dan dukungan aplikasi yang harus dilakukan secara berkala bagi produk digital bisnis Anda.
 
 
 
Berikut adalah beberapa pemahaman dan langkah penting dalam mengembangkan mobile apps sebagai salah satu alat pemasaran bagi bisnis dan produk digital Anda.
Untuk Anda yang saat ini membutuhkan layanan Mobile App Development di Jakarta baik dalam industri Anda seperti jasa Konsultasi Produk, Project Management, UI / UX Design, Development, Testing, Deployment (ke server App Store / PlayStore atas nama perusahaan klien), Source-Code, serta FREE Maintenance selama 3 bulan,  EANNOVATE dapat menjadi solusi Anda.
 
Untuk melengkapi hal diatas, kami juga memberikan layanan SEO Digital Marketing di Jakarta lengkap dengan copywriter untuk mendukung aktivitas online dari bisnis Anda. Anda sedang mencari portal berita yang menyajikan informasi teknologi kreatif yang dilengkapi dengan berita startup, info gadget terupdate, dan berita di dunia IT terbaru serta terkini? Alterspace solusinya.


Comments